ACM SUI brings together top researchers and practitioners from around the world who focus on spatial interaction for Virtual Reality, Augmented Reality, Mixed Reality, and for ubiquitous, intelligent/smart and real environments. We invite contributions from a wide range of fields including design, social science, arts and creative Industries, and other application domains. This year we introduce a new track of workshops and special topic sessions that are organised by our participants to discuss more focused and/or emerging research and technical topics. TOPICS

All topics that are directly or indirectly relevant to spatial user interactions and interfaces are welcome. Topics of interest include, but are not limited to:

Design practices, principles and frameworks

Interaction design, usability and user experience (UX)

User interface metaphors

Evaluation methodologies and metrics

Perception and cognition

Human factors and ergonomics

Ethical, social, cultural and language factors

Inclusion and accessibility

Privacy and security

Empathy, trust, acceptance and safety

Interactive spatial computer graphics

Spatial input devices and technology

Haptics, spatial audio, touch, tangible, gesture based spatial interactions and interfaces

Multimodal/multisensory and other novel forms of spatial interaction and perception

Spatial interaction with data, virtual humans and avatars

Distributed, multi-user and collaborative spatial interaction

Immersive analytics and visualisation

Intelligent spatial interfaces, interaction and collaboration

User adaptive spatial interaction and personalization

Applications of human spatial perception to interaction

Applications of spatial UIs, such as games, entertainment, CAD, education, health, engineering
